ACV achieves nearly VND10,750 billion revenue in 6 months 

 Tuesday, July 14,2026

AsemconnectVietnam - Vietnam Airports Corporation (ACV) recently held a conference to review the first six months of the year, consolidate leadership personnel, and accelerate the completion of key aviation projects.

Despite the aviation industry still facing many challenges from geopolitical fluctuations, fuel costs, logistics, and financial pressure, Vietnam Airports Corporation (ACV) has maintained safe and stable operations at 22 airports nationwide, while accelerating the progress of key infrastructure projects to achieve its business production targets for 2026.
At the conference reviewing the work of the first six months of the year, the Party Committee of the Ministry of Finance announced and presented the decision approving the position of Secretary of the Party Committee of Vietnam Airports Corporation, term 2025–2030, to Mr. Nguyen Cao Cuong - Chairman of the Board of Directors of ACV. This is important content, contributing to the consolidation of the Party Committee's leadership structure within the Corporation, ensuring unified and continuous leadership during the period when ACV is implementing many key tasks in production, business, investment, development, and system stability.
In the first half of 2026, ACV served nearly 61 million passengers, an increase of over 6% compared to the same period last year, including over 24 million international passengers and nearly 37 million domestic passengers. Cargo and parcel throughput at airports reached nearly 920,000 tons, an increase of nearly 13%, while the number of takeoffs and landings reached nearly 370,000, an increase of nearly 5%.
Regarding business results, ACV recorded VND10,745 billion in revenue, an increase of 1.78% compared to the same period; pre-tax profit reached VND5,862 billion, completing 83.61% of the annual plan. The company has also contributed VND1,635 billion to the state budget.
In the field of infrastructure investment, ACV is focusing its resources on implementing the "180-day acceleration program" to ensure that Long Thanh International Airport is put into operation by the end of 2026. In addition, the company aims to bring Lien Khuong Airport back into operation from August 19, 2026, Ca Mau Airport into operation from November 1, 2026, and complete the Cat Bi Airport cargo terminal in August 2026, along with many infrastructure upgrade projects throughout the system.
